Courses: Social Studies

Students graduating from CVHS must earn 2.5 credits (5 semesters) of credits in the Social Studies Departments.

*3 credits required for 4-year college

COURSE NUMBER

COURSE NAME

INFORMATION

5020

Global Studies

Required for graduation for 2007 and beyond.

5110

Geography—The Study of the World

Will satisfy 4 yr. college requirement.

5211

U.S. History I (1880-1941)

Required for graduation.

5212

U.S. History II (1941-present)

Required for graduation.

5221 & 5222

Humanities I & II

Block classes:  5221, 5222, 1321 & 1322.  Satisfies US History and LA requirements.

5310

Psychology

Elective Only.

5330

Sociology

Will satisfy 4 yr. college requirement.

5340

Sociology II

Will satisfy 4 yr. college requirement.

5420

Government

Required for graduation.

5450

Current World Problems

Required for graduation.

5460

Holocaust

Will satisfy 4 yr. college requirement.

5991 & 5992

Advanced Placement U.S. History I & II

Specific testing & grade requirement criteria.  Satisfies US History requirement.

5994 & 5995

Advanced Placement European History I & II

Specific testing & grade requirement criteria.  Satisfies Current World Problems requirement.

5996 & 5997

Advanced Placement Government

Specific testing & grade requirement criteria. Satisfies Government and Current World Problems requirement.
